    Default 1985 Force 50hp Oil seep hole in upper gear housing ????

    There seems to be a seep hole next to a bolt on my upper gear housing ( pic attached) that oil comes out of slowly (into the water) when I run the motor in a trash can. I am wondering what the purpose is for this since I cant find anything about it. it looks like a 1/16th hole drilled upward right next a the bolt that holds on the leg directly above the gear oil fill plug. Anyone have an idea? quite a bit of dark but thin oil accumulates in my 33 gal trash can while running the motor. seems to be from the 2 stroke oil it smells like it.????? When I tilt the motor up after running it, alot of water runs out too.

    Default Re: 1985 Force 50hp Oil seep hole in upper gear housing ????

    It's a drain.The 2 strokes don't burn all the fuel and oil.Some leaks from the carb.
    Water actually gets up inside the housing and will drain out after you pull the boat.
    Absolutly normal,unless you have LOT LOT LOT in the can.
    How does it run normaly?Jerry
